ROM (Read-Only Memory)
ROM (Read-Only Memory), bilgisayarların ve diğer dijital cihazların kalıcı bellek türlerinden biridir. ROM, verilerin yalnızca okunabilir olduğu bir bellek türüdür; yani, veriler yazılabilirken çok sınırlıdır ve genellikle sadece cihazın üretimi sırasında bir kez yazılır. Bu, ROM'u sistemin temel yazılımlarını, firmware'ini ve donanımın başlangıç talimatlarını depolamak için ideal kılar.ROM'un Temel Özellikleri
-
Okuma Sadece (Read-Only):ROM’daki veriler, genellikle sadece okunabilir. Veriler kullanıcı veya cihaz tarafından değiştirilmez. Bu, sistemin güvenliğini artırır, çünkü donanımın çalışmasını etkileyebilecek değişiklikler yapılması zordur.
-
Kalıcı Depolama:ROM, elektrik kesildiğinde verileri kaybetmez. Bu, ROM’un kalıcı bir bellek türü olmasını sağlar. Örneğin, BIOS veya UEFI yazılımı ROM’da depolanır ve cihaz kapalı olsa bile bu veriler kaybolmaz.
-
Sabit Veri:ROM’a yazılan veriler sabittir ve genellikle sistemin başlangıç fonksiyonlarını (örneğin, BIOS veya firmware) içerir. Bu veriler genellikle donanımın temel işlevlerini başlatan programlardır.
-
Güvenilirlik ve Dayanıklılık:ROM, veri kaybı yaşama riski düşük olan dayanıklı bir bellek türüdür. Elektrik kesilse bile verileri saklamaya devam eder.
ROM Türleri
-
MROM (Masked ROM):Maskeli ROM, üretim aşamasında tamamen yazılan, yalnızca okunabilen bir bellek türüdür. Maskeli ROM, üretici tarafından tasarlanır ve içeriği değiştirilmesi mümkün değildir. Bu tür ROM’lar genellikle düşük maliyetli ve sabit içerikli yazılımlar için kullanılır.
-
PROM (Programmable ROM):PROM, kullanıcıların belirli bir programlama cihazı ile yazabileceği bir ROM türüdür. PROM, fabrikada “boş” gelir ve kullanıcı veya üretici tarafından yazılır. Ancak yazıldıktan sonra tekrar silinemez veya değiştirilemez.
-
EPROM (Erasable Programmable ROM):EPROM, ultraviyole ışık ile silinebilen ve tekrar programlanabilen bir ROM türüdür. EPROM'un üst kısmında pencere bulunur; bu pencere sayesinde ışık, içindeki verileri silebilir ve yeniden yazılmasını sağlar. Bu özellik, EPROM'u bazı özel uygulamalar için kullanışlı kılar.
-
EEPROM (Electrically Erasable Programmable ROM):EEPROM, elektrikle silinebilen ve yeniden yazılabilen bir ROM türüdür. EEPROM, EPROM'dan farklı olarak dış bir ışık kaynağına ihtiyaç duymaz, bunun yerine elektriksel sinyallerle veri silme ve yazma işlemleri yapılabilir. EEPROM, bilgisayar donanımlarında ve özellikle mikrodenetleyicilerde yaygın olarak kullanılır.
-
Flash ROM (Flash Memory):Flash ROM, EEPROM’un bir çeşidi olup, daha hızlı ve daha güvenilir veri silme ve yazma işlemleri sağlar. Flash bellek, genellikle USB bellekler, SSD'ler ve modern bilgisayar donanımlarında kullanılır. Flash ROM, verilerin bloklar halinde silinip yeniden yazılmasını sağlar, bu da daha hızlı işlem süreleri sağlar.
ROM'un Kullanım Alanları
-
Bilgisayarlar ve Sunucular:ROM, bilgisayarların BIOS veya UEFI yazılımını depolamak için kullanılır. Bu yazılımlar, bilgisayarın açılışında gerekli olan temel işlemleri gerçekleştirir (örneğin, POST - Power On Self Test).
-
Elektronik Cihazlar:ROM, televizyonlar, ses sistemleri, ev aletleri, araba elektronik sistemleri gibi birçok elektronik cihazda, cihazın temel işletim sistemi veya firmware’ini depolamak için kullanılır.
-
Mobil Cihazlar:Mobil telefonlarda, ROM, cihazın işletim sistemi ve uygulamalarını depolayan bellek olarak işlev görür. Örneğin, Android telefonlarında, cihazın orijinal yazılımı ROM içinde depolanır.
-
Otomotiv Elektroniği:Araçlarda, ROM’un temel işlevi motor kontrol üniteleri (ECU) ve diğer kritik sistemlerin yazılımını depolamaktır.
-
Mikrodenetleyiciler ve Gömülü Sistemler:Gömülü sistemler, mikrodenetleyiciler kullanarak çeşitli otomasyon ve kontrol işlevlerini gerçekleştirir. Bu tür sistemlerde ROM, yazılım ve firmware’i depolamak için kullanılır.
ROM ve RAM Arasındaki Farklar
-
Veri Yazma Yeteneği:
- ROM: Veriler yalnızca okunabilir ve genellikle sabittir. Veri yazma işlemi çok sınırlıdır veya imkansızdır.
- RAM: Veri yazılabilir ve silinebilir, ancak bilgisayar kapatıldığında RAM'deki veriler kaybolur.
-
Depolama Süresi:
- ROM: Kalıcı bellektir, yani elektrik kesildiğinde bile veriler kaybolmaz.
- RAM: Geçici bellektir; bilgisayar kapandığında veya yeniden başlatıldığında RAM'deki veriler kaybolur.
-
Kullanım Amacı:
- ROM: Cihazların temel yazılımlarını (firmware, BIOS, işletim sistemi) depolamak için kullanılır.
- RAM: Çalışan uygulamalar ve veriler için geçici depolama sağlar.
ROM’un Avantajları ve Dezavantajları
Avantajları:
- Kalıcılık: ROM’daki veriler, cihaz kapalı olsa bile kaybolmaz.
- Güvenlik: Veriler değiştirilmediği için cihazın çalışmasını etkileyecek istenmeyen yazılımlar veya değişiklikler engellenir.
- Düşük Maliyet: Sabit işlevler için ROM kullanmak, cihaz üretim maliyetlerini azaltabilir.
Dezavantajları:
- Esneklik Eksikliği: ROM’a yazılan veriler genellikle sabittir ve güncellenmesi zordur.
- Depolama Kapasitesi: ROM, sınırlı bir depolama alanına sahiptir ve büyük veri depolama gereksinimlerini karşılayamaz.
Sonuç
ROM (Read-Only Memory), dijital cihazların temel işlevlerini yerine getirmesi için gerekli olan yazılımları depolayan kalıcı bir bellek türüdür. Veriler sabit olup, genellikle donanımın başlatılması, firmware ve diğer temel işlevlerin kontrol edilmesi için kullanılır. ROM’un farklı türleri, cihazın ihtiyaçlarına göre esneklik sağlar ve her tür, belirli bir kullanım amacına yöneliktir.
Hiç yorum yok:
Yorum Gönder
Yorumunuz İçin Teşekkürler